How to Plant Every Seed in My Cut Flower Collection

Just scroll down for all of the individual directions for each seed found in my Cut Flowers Collection. This is what you would find on the back of the seed packet!

1. ZINNIAS

Planting Time: After last frost
Sun: Full sun (6–8+ hrs)

How to Plant:
Direct sow • Lightly cover • Space 6–12” or just throw and grow!

Water: Light every day until established

Germination: 3–7 days
Blooms: 60–75 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Toss more seeds if they don’t sprout in a week! (Read my free guide here!)


2. COSMOS

Planting Time: After last frost
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:
Direct sow • Barely cover

Water: Low

Germination: 5–10 days
Blooms: ~60 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
They thrive on neglect (seriously) Read more here!


3. SUNFLOWERS (Dwarf + Multi-Bloom)

When to Plant: After last frost

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Plant 1 inch deep
  • Space 6–12 inches

Water: Moderate

Germination: 7–10 days

Bloom Time: ~60–75 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Plant a few every 1–2 weeks for continuous blooms.


4. SNAPDRAGONS

When to Plant: Early spring (can handle light frost)

Sun: Full sun to partial

How to Plant:

  • Surface sow (do NOT cover seeds)
  • Press gently into soil

Water: Keep evenly moist

Germination: 10–14 days

Bloom Time: ~80–100 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
These are slow starters, but so worth it for early blooms.


5. SWEET PEAS

When to Plant: Early spring (cool weather lover!)

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Plant 1 inch deep
  • Provide support (trellis or fence)

Water: Moderate

Germination: 10–21 days

Bloom Time: ~70–90 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Plant early, they hate heat but LOVE cool spring weather.


6. LARKSPUR

When to Plant: Early spring or fall

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Lightly cover seeds

Water: Light to moderate

Germination: 14–21 days

Bloom Time: ~90 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Plant it once and you may get volunteers next year


7. BACHELOR BUTTONS (Cornflower)

When to Plant: Early spring or after last frost

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Lightly cover

Water: Low

Germination: 7–10 days

Bloom Time: ~60–70 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Perfect “filler flower” for that wild, cottage garden look.


8. CALENDULA

When to Plant: Early spring or after frost

Sun: Full sun to partial

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Cover lightly

Water: Moderate

Germination: 7–14 days

Bloom Time: ~50–60 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
They’ll often reseed themselves which means free flowers next year!


9. NASTURTIUM

When to Plant: After last frost

Sun: Full sun to partial

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ow
  • Plant ½–1 inch deep

Water: Low

Germination: 7–14 days

Bloom Time: ~50–60 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Poor soil = MORE blooms (they don’t like being pampered)


10. MARIGOLDS

When to Plant: After last frost

Sun: Full sun

How to Plant:

  • Direct sow or transplant
  • Cover lightly

Water: Moderate

Germination: 5–7 days

Bloom Time: ~50–60 days

Lazy Girl Tip:
Great for borders AND helping deter pests.
